Muine/Phanthiet
click to see big picture
Mui Ne is located 24 km north-east of the town of Phan Thiet. It is a fishing village as well as a familiar tourism area in Binh Thuan Province.

Mui Ne has long been considered the "Hawaii" of Vietnam. It boasts shady roads under coconut trees, a beautiful beach and cliffs battered by the waves of the sea. The typical scenery of Mui Ne lies in the moving lines of golden sand caused by the wind and when they are seen from afar they look like moving waves.
 The scenery looks more fascinating at dawn, when young Cham girls in green dresses go to work. That's why no photographer fails to visit this area.
